-By default, Event Grid namespaces and entities in them such as Message Queuing Telemetry Transport (MQTT) topic spaces are accessible from internet as long as the request comes with valid authentication (access key) and authorization. With IP firewall, you can restrict it further to only a set of IPv4 addresses or IPv4 address ranges in [CIDR (Classless Inter-Domain Routing)](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Classless_Inter-Domain_Routing) notation. Publishers originating from any other IP address are rejected and receive a 403 (Forbidden) response.
